云服务器选应用镜像还是系统镜像好?

服务器

结论:选择云服务器镜像时,应根据具体需求决定。如果需要快速部署特定应用或服务,建议选择应用镜像;如果需要更高的灵活性和自定义能力,则选择系统镜像更合适。


一、什么是应用镜像和系统镜像?

  • 应用镜像:已经预装了特定应用程序(如WordPress、LAMP栈、Docker等)的镜像,通常经过优化,可以直接运行目标应用。
  • 系统镜像:仅包含操作系统的基础环境(如Ubuntu、CentOS、Debian等),用户需要自行安装和配置所需的应用程序。

二、应用镜像的优点

  • 快速部署:应用镜像已经包含了完整的运行环境和软件包,用户无需从零开始安装和配置,节省大量时间。
  • 降低技术门槛:对于不熟悉Linux操作系统的用户来说,应用镜像提供了“开箱即用”的体验,降低了使用难度。
  • 减少出错概率:官方或可信来源提供的应用镜像通常经过严格测试,避免了手动安装过程中可能出现的兼容性或配置错误问题。

例如,如果你需要搭建一个博客网站,选择一个预装了WordPress的应用镜像,几分钟内即可完成部署并开始使用。


三、系统镜像的优点

  • 高度灵活:系统镜像只提供基础的操作系统环境,用户可以根据需求自由安装任何软件或服务,适合对服务器有复杂定制需求的场景。
  • 安全性更高:由于没有预装任何额外的软件,攻击面相对较小,用户可以按需安装最小化依赖的软件包。
  • 性能优化:用户可以根据实际需求调整系统参数和软件配置,从而获得更好的性能表现。

例如,如果你是一名开发者,需要在服务器上运行多个自定义开发工具和服务,那么系统镜像是更好的选择。


四、适用场景对比

应用镜像适用场景:

  • 需要快速搭建常见应用(如博客、论坛、电商网站等)。
  • 技术能力有限,希望减少配置工作量。
  • 对服务器性能要求不高,或者应用本身已经进行了优化。

系统镜像适用场景:

  • 需要深度定制服务器环境,运行特定业务或服务。
  • 关注安全性,希望减少不必要的软件安装。
  • 对性能有较高要求,需要手动调优系统和应用。

五、注意事项

  • 镜像来源:无论是应用镜像还是系统镜像,都应选择官方或可信第三方提供的版本,以确保安全性和稳定性。
  • 备份与维护:应用镜像虽然方便,但可能无法满足所有个性化需求,后续仍需进行一定维护。系统镜像则需要更多的初始配置工作。
  • 成本考量:部分云服务商可能会对某些高级应用镜像收取额外费用,而系统镜像通常是免费的。

六、总结

  • 如果你的目标是快速启动并运行某个特定应用,且对底层环境没有过多要求,那么选择应用镜像无疑是最佳方案。
  • 如果你追求灵活性安全性,并且具备一定的技术能力,那么选择系统镜像将更适合你的需求。

最终的选择取决于你的技术水平、项目需求以及对时间和资源的权衡。

未经允许不得转载:CDNK博客 » 云服务器选应用镜像还是系统镜像好?